NEC’s nine-match unbeaten run is on the line as they face resilient Entebbe UPPC at Lugogo under floodlights on Tuesday.
The ‘Diehards’ last lost a game on December 12 last year against KCCA and have since won five and drawn four in the league.
Their newfound form has seen them rise to the table and are now 7th with 30 points, just five behind the Printers who are winless in three matches in succession in all competitions.
Badru Kaddu is hopeful of extending a good run despite hosting a side he termed as tough.
“The preparations are good and we have players like Richard Basangwa, Pius Obuya and Muhammad Ssenoga back from injury and that gives us viable options,” Kaddu told the press.
“The opponents (UPPC) are ahead of us and we need to be alert but as long as we get the goals, I believe we shall win because that is all we want,” he added.
Entebbe UPPC who are 5th on the table could hand debuts to Abraham Tusubira and Laban Tibita who missed the goalless draw against URA.
Ambrose Kigozi, Julius Poloto and Nasur Saddick will be key for the visitors who are aiming to stay in the title contention.
The reverse fixture at Bugonga ended in a 1-0 defeat for NEC with Samuel Kawawa netting the winning goal.
Elsewhere on Tuesday, record champions SC Villa visit 2005 winners Police, BUL visit Buhimba at Royal Park Butema in Hoima, Mbarara City host Kitara in the Western Derby while Calvary visit Maroons at Midigo.
